The Ambiguous Figure

An ambiguous figure is an image that can be interpreted in multiple ways, depending on how your brain perceives it. These images often contain hidden or multiple shapes, causing viewers to switch between different perceptions. For example, some figures might look like two different objects or faces, depending on your focus. This phenomenon reveals how our perception is influenced by context, prior experiences, and mental processes. Ambiguous figures are used in psychology to study visual perception and cognition, demonstrating how our mind actively constructs what we see rather than just passively recording it.
